The diversion tunnel is 11 feet (3.4m) wide, 14 feet (4.3m) high, and 6,666 feet (2,032m) long and was tunneled through solid rock and then lined with concrete. Tallulah Falls Lake is a 63-acre (250,000m2) reservoir with 3.6 miles (5.8km) of shoreline located in the Northeastern corner of Georgia in Rabun County. Rabun County Lakes (15) The Tallulah Falls Hydroelectric Plant is located 608 feet (185m) lower than the dam at the lower end of the tunnel and has a generation capacity of 72,000 kilowatts. North and South Rim Trails The North and South Rim Trails are twotrails that follow the rim of the Gorge, are approximately three-quarters of a mile each, and offer spectacular overlooks into the Gorge with views of the Falls. It is the fourth and smallest lake in a six-lake series created by hydroelectric dams operated by Georgia Power that follows the original course of the Tallulah River. The Tallulah Gorge State Park is the home of five gorgeous waterfalls: Hurricane Falls, Tempesta Falls, Oceana Falls, Bridal Veil Falls (also known as Sliding Rock falls), and LEau dOr.
